Before Udyr's rebalance, he had that exact function along with a mana return. It made turtle a first max requirement before it would fall off late game because building tanky gave it less of an impact. Maxing it early gave him an obscene amount of sustain in the jungle, but also pidgeonholed him into building heavy attack speed. This doesn't help his alternative role of being an amazing pusher. In fact it even hurts tiger stance in terms of its usefulness.
Honestly, as an Udyr player, I prefer being up to functionally use lifesteal/damage items in the late game and being able to max an alternative spell that isn't turtle first. Building ravenous hydra gives him a sizable health return with spirit visage, the rest of his build can even settle on being tanky and actually being useful in the late game.
